THE PREDICTION

Luton will be happy at returning to home comforts this weekend, having gone two further away games without winning over the past week. At home however, the Hatters are far more comfortable considering they last game at Kenilworth Road was a win over league leaders Norwich. Preston meanwhile, will be hoping to continue on the path towards a long unbeaten run, after a dominating 3-0 win over Middlesbrough last time out, their third successive league game without defeat. Both of these sides are fairly evenly matched, with each currently sitting on 23 points. This should lead to a tight contest and ultimately the two teams most likely having to settle for a point apiece.
